I found an oops in one of our template1 databases; tables and stuff were
apparently loaded into the wrong database (namely template1). I found
this page describing a solution:
http://techdocs.postgresql.org/techdocs/pgsqladventuresep1.php

But, this looks kind of risky to me. I'd prefer not to put our running
databases at risk.

As an alternative approach, wouldn't dropping and recreating the public
schema be a nice alternative? And in that case, what would be the right
CREATE SCHEMA public command? I don't feel like messing this up ;)
